yangmei
English
Etymology
Borrowed from Mandarin ?? (yángméi).
Noun
yangmei (plural yangmeis)
- The edible crimson fruit of the subtropical tree Myrica rubra.
- The tree itself.
Synonyms
- (fruit): yumberry, Chinese bayberry, Japanese bayberry, red bayberry, yamamomo, waxberry
- (tree): Chinese strawberry (not to be confused with the Chinese strawberry tree)
